Which one of the following factors does not lead to soil formation in nature?

  1. Sunlight

  2. Water

  3. Wind

  4. Polythene bag

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ation

Rain, wind, ice and temperature changes break the tough, hard parent material or rocks. This process is very slow but it steadily continues. Such broken parts are further withered by same factors as well as some other factors as acids etc. Therefore, wind, water and the Sun are involved in soil formation. 

Polythene bags are not involved in soil formation. However, plastic bags are threat to environment, because these bags are non-degradable, i.e., do not decay and thus, do not lead to soil formation.

What is best pH of soil for cultivation?

  1. 3.4 - 5.4

  2. 4.5 - 5.5

  3. 5.5 - 6.5

  4. 6.5 - 7.5

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
C Correct answer
Explanation

  • Soil nature is described in pH values. It can be alkaline, acidic or neutral. 
  • Highly acidic and highly saline soil often remains injurious for plant growth, microorganisms, etc. 
  • Soil pH strongly affects microbial activities. Neutral or slightly acidic soil (5.5-6.5) remains best for the growth of the majority of plants.

Therefore, the correct answer is option C.

In which part of atmosphere, ozone layer is present?

  1. Stratosphere

  2. Troposphere

  3. Mesosphere

  4. Thermosphere

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
A Correct answer
Explanation

The ozone layer is mainly found in the lower portion of the stratosphere, from approximately 20 to 30 kilometres above Earth, which shields the earth from the sun's harmful ultraviolet radiations. Ozone gas is present in 10 ppm in this ozone layer.
